'Municipal Government in Michigan and Ohio' delves into the intricacies of local governance in these two pivotal Midwestern states. Delos Franklin Wilcox provides a detailed examination of the structures, functions, and challenges faced by municipal governments during the late 19th and early 20th centuries. This study offers valuable insights into the historical development of urban administration and policy-making. Wilcox explores various aspects of municipal organization, including charters, elections, public services, and fiscal management. He analyzes the political dynamics shaping local decision-making processes, shedding light on the interplay between different stakeholders and interest groups. By comparing and contrasting the experiences of Michigan and Ohio, Wilcox highlights both common trends and unique regional variations in municipal governance.
